Southport, NC vs Miami, FL

Side-by-side comparison of monthly climate normals (NOAA 1991-2020).

Southport is cooler than Miami (65°F vs 76.1°F annual avg) and similar rainfall to it (54.6 in vs 57.2 in per year). Southport has a Humid subtropical climate; Miami a Tropical monsoon climate.

Month-by-month comparison

Month Southport Miami
High Low Precip High Low Precip
January 60.0°F 35.5°F 3.70 in 73.6°F 61.2°F 2.33 in
February 62.5°F 37.6°F 3.32 in 74.8°F 63.3°F 2.27 in
March 68.2°F 42.7°F 4.03 in 76.5°F 65.2°F 2.47 in
April 75.8°F 50.9°F 3.08 in 79.6°F 69.8°F 3.44 in
May 82.5°F 60.0°F 3.44 in 82.7°F 73.6°F 4.94 in
June 88.4°F 69.0°F 4.02 in 86.0°F 76.5°F 7.76 in
July 91.6°F 72.8°F 5.55 in 87.8°F 78.0°F 5.98 in
August 90.4°F 71.2°F 6.77 in 88.1°F 78.1°F 7.51 in
September 86.5°F 66.0°F 8.16 in 87.0°F 77.2°F 8.45 in
October 78.9°F 54.4°F 5.41 in 83.7°F 74.4°F 6.49 in
November 69.9°F 44.3°F 3.42 in 78.9°F 68.6°F 3.29 in
December 62.9°F 38.0°F 3.74 in 76.1°F 64.6°F 2.25 in
